The Flag of Madagascar: 13 Fascinating Facts

The flag of Madagascar is a symbol of the nation’s rich history, culture, and natural beauty. This island nation, located off the southeastern coast of Africa, boasts a unique flag that tells a story of its past and its promising future. In this article, we will explore 13 fascinating facts about the flag of Madagascar,…

Tourism in Madagascar 

Tourism in Madagascar is big business. But why is the tourism industry so important here and why does it matter? Read on to find out… Tourism in Madagascar The expansive island nation of Madagascar, nestled in the Indian Ocean off the southeastern coast of Africa, beckons travelers with an invitation to a world where nature’s…

